PRO TIP: Can You Live Stream From Wix?
Yes, but there are some things to keep in mind before you do.
First, Wix does not currently offer live streaming in HD. So, if you’re looking to stream in high definition, you’ll need to use another service.
Second, Wix’s live streaming feature is still in beta. This means that there may be some bugs and glitches that need to be ironed out. So, if you’re planning on using Wix for live streaming, be sure to keep an eye out for updates and new features.
Overall, yes, you can live stream from Wix. But there are a few things to keep in mind before you do.
To live stream on Wix, you’ll first need to create a Wix account and then create a site. Once you’ve done that, you can go to the Wix Live app and start streaming. The app will walk you through the steps of setting up your live stream, and then you can start sharing your content with the world!

Yes, you can play videos on Wix. You can either upload them directly from your computer, or embed them from YouTube or Vimeo. To upload a video from your computer, click the “Add” button on the left-hand side of the Wix Editor.
There are a few different ways that you can stream live on Wix. The first way is to use the Wix Video App. This app allows you to connect your Wix account to your YouTube channel and live stream directly from YouTube.
Yes, you can play music on Wix. You can add music to your Wix site by embedding a music player from a third-party provider, such as Spotify, SoundCloud, or Bandcamp. You can also upload your own audio files and create a custom audio player.
